How long is Snake Road in Illinois?
about 2.7 miles
Forest Road #345 – better known as Snake Road – winds about 2.7 miles through the LaRue-Pine Hills of the Shawnee National Forest in southern Illinois, according to a video from the U.S. Forest Service.

Is Snake Pass open A57?
On 29 March 2022, the route was reopened to all vehicles, with a weight limit of 7.5t, and with traffic lights and a 20mph speed restriction at the location of all three landslides.

What kind of snakes are on Snake Road in Illinois?
There are over 20 different species of snakes just at Snake Road! Illinois’s three main venomous snakes are all located on this road, including copperhead, cottonmouth, and timber rattlesnake. You will likely see cottonmouth (water moccasins) more than any other snake while visiting the road.
What do you do if you come across a snake trail?
If you see or hear a snake, the best thing to do is to stop, assess the situation, slowly back away, and wait at a safe distance for the snake to leave. If there is a way to detour far around the snake, that’s a good option too. Don’t try to scare the snake away, approach the snake, or move the snake.
Is Snake Pass and Woodhead the same?
Although Snake Pass is still the shortest route between Manchester and Sheffield, the more northerly Woodhead Pass, which is less steep and at a lower altitude, is now the primary road link between the two cities. Unlike Snake Pass, the Woodhead route is a trunk road.
Why is it called Snake Pass?
Despite what some people think, the pass takes its name from the serpent-headed coat of arms of the Dukes of Devonshire, and not from its winding nature.

What was Benoni called before?
Little Cornwall
The village became known as “Little Cornwall” for a time. Sir George Farrar, the chairman of a mining company, undertook the planning of the rapidly growing mining town in 1904. A river was dammed into a series of dams for mine use. Today these dams remain and are populated with fish.
